Bali calls for dialogue with agitating PTA teachers
Kangra, Oct 12 (UNI) Former Himachal Pradesh Transport Minister and MLA G S Bali has urged the state government to start negotiations with the agitating PTA and HRTC employees and sort out the issues amicably.
Addressing a press conference at his residence here today, he said that HRTC was a disciplined organisation but required proper attention of the government. He said that Transport Minister Kishen Kappor must rise to the occasion and bring the HRTC employees across the table and accept their genuine demands.
Mr Bali said that the previous Congress government as a policy matter appointed PTA so that education reaches every nook and corner of the state. He said that it was unjustified and against the government policy to show door to all the PTA teachers.
He further said that a committee was formulated to see if there was any violation made in the criteria adopted in case of the appointments of the PTA teachers. He called for a dialogue with the agitating PTA.
